The Climate

Makarska Riviera has characteristics of Mediterranean climate. Summers are hot with the periods of drought, and the rest of the seasons are characterized by rains and moderate temperatures. The highest temperatures are in July and August. At the areas that are exposed to strong winds, the temperature at night can fall below 0 Celsius degrees.

Baška Voda is characterized by mild, humid winters and hot, sunny and dry summers. The average temperatures are: in July: air: 24, 4 Celsius degrees (sea temperature is 25 Celsius degrees) and in January – air: 8, 3 Celsius degrees (sea temperature is 13, 5 Celsius degrees). Baška Voda has over 2700 sunny days in a year and it is located in the one of the sunniest areas of the northern Mediterranean. On average, over 40 days in a year are warmer than 30 Celsius degrees, and only 7 days are below 0.
